Responsibilities
Manage and process payroll tax filings for multiple jurisdictions, including federal, state, and local agencies.
Prepare and submit periodic (monthly, quarterly) and annual payroll tax returns accurately and on time.
Reconcile payroll tax accounts and resolve discrepancies.
Maintain compliance with IRS and state tax regulations.
Research and resolve tax notices from federal, state, and local agencies.
Utilize MasterTax software to prepare, file, and monitor tax submissions.
Collaborate with internal payroll, accounting, and HR teams to ensure alignment across all filings.
Stay up to date on tax law changes and filing requirements.
Qualifications
2+ years of experience in payroll tax filing or payroll operations.
Strong knowledge of federal, state, and local payroll tax requirements.
Experience with MasterTax software (highly preferred).
Proficiency in Excel and payroll systems (e.g., ADP, Paychex, Workday, or similar).
Excellent attention to detail, organizational skills, and ability to manage multiple deadlines.
Strong problem-solving and communication skills.
